Certificate II in Maritime Operations (Marine Engine Driver Grade 3 Near Coastal)
Nationally Recognised Vocational Education and Training (VET) This qualification is for individuals seeking to work as engineers within the maritime or seafood industries. It provides the necessary skills to operate and maintain engines on commercial vessels.Delivery mode
